Mrs. Marlene Webb, born February 3, 1938, better known as Sally to her friends and family, passed away at the Adventist HealthCare White Oak Medical Center on September 11, 2022, with her family beside her.

She was born in Takoma Park at the Seventy Day Adventist Hospital. She grew up in Laurel. After high school she started working for the CIA until she met her husband, Charles Webb; and married on January 8, 1961.

She enjoyed playing bingo with her cousins and friends, she also enjoyed coloring in adult coloring books and going to the casinos as a past time.

She was preceded in death by her mother, Sylvia McGue; brother, Edward McGue; and her husband, Charles Webb.

She is survived by her daughter, Jennifer Jeffries (Craig); granddaughters: Abagail and Gabrielle; also by her closest cousins: Roberrt (Bobby) Long, Cheryl Beall and Jeanette Beall; and other family.
